Practice Areas

Emily Lambright focuses her practice on federal taxation, employee benefits and qualified retirement plans, estate and gift tax planning, and tax-exempt organizations and nonprofit law. She is a certified public accountant.

Emily represents individuals and businesses by counseling them on income and estate tax issues, business succession planning, entity formation and selection, and transactional tax matters. She also provides guidance on benefits matters and executive compensation to clients.

She received her law degree in 2009 from the West Virginia University College of Law, where she was a member of the Moot Court’s National Team and a recipient of the Order of the Barristers. Emily earned her bachelor’s degree and a master’s in business administration degree (MBA) from WVU.
